Gwadar students visit PU
By our correspondents
December 20, 2016
LAHORE
On the invitation of the Punjab government, a delegation of students and teachers of different academic institutions of Gwadar reached the provincial metropolis on Monday.
The delegation reached through Pakistan Air Force’s C-130 aircraft at Lahore Airport from where they reached Punjab University through special buses.
A lunch was hosted by Punjab University in the honour of delegation in which PU Registrar Prof Dr Liaqat Ali, Director Students Affairs Shahid Gul, Higher Education Department Deputy Secretary Nauman Jamil, Director Colleges Muhammad Zahid, Deputy Adviser Students Affairs Zubair Ahmed and others were present. The delegation will visit various departments of Punjab University on Tuesday (today).
